New Zealand`s entrance matting import market in 2024 saw a continued high concentration with top exporting countries being India, Sri Lanka, China, Australia, and the USA. Despite a negative CAGR of -1.17% from 2020 to 2024 and a steep decline in growth rate of -12.81% from 2023 to 2024, the market remains competitive with a range of suppliers catering to the country`s demand for quality entrance matting products. The market dynamics indicate the importance of monitoring trends and adapting strategies to navigate challenges and capitalize on opportunities in this sector.

By 2027, New Zealand's Entrance Matting market is forecasted to achieve a stable growth rate of 4.17%, with China leading the Asia region, followed by India, Japan, Australia and South Korea.
